Size and Height Considerations

Size really matters when choosing a sisal cat tower. My cat, Milo, loves to perch high up, so a taller tower with multiple levels is a must for him. Towers around 60 inches tend to suit most cats’ climbing needs while providing ample space for lounging.

Consider your living space too. A tower that fits well in your room looks better and doesn’t take over your space. I learned that keeping it near a window often gets my cat more interested.

Maintenance of Sisal Cat Towers

Keeping sisal cat towers looking great and functional is simple. Regular care not only extends their lifespan but ensures a safe and enjoyable experience for cats like my Ragdoll, Milo.

Cleaning Tips

Cleaning sisal cat towers offers a chance to bond with your furry friend while keeping their play area neat. I vacuum mine weekly to pick up fur and dirt. A damp cloth can tackle tougher spots. Occasional light scrubbing with a solution of water and mild soap works wonders. Repairing Damage

Repairing wear and tear on sisal towers can seem daunting. Thankfully, I’ve found that re-wrapping a damaged post with fresh sisal rope is often all it takes. You can buy sisal rope in most pet stores or online. For small nicks or tears, a simple knot or adhesive should suffice.
